  • Spanish Steps: A remarkable 18th-century stairway of 135 steps, the Spanish Steps connect the Piazza di Spagna and the Trinità dei Monti church. This historic site is not only a popular gathering spot but also offers a vibrant atmosphere, surrounded by charming boutiques and cafes.
  • Pantheon: An architectural marvel, the Pantheon boasts a stunning dome and oculus that create a magnificent play of light. This ancient building, originally a temple, now serves as a church and is a testament to Rome's rich history and artistry.
  • Piazza Navona: Renowned for its beautiful fountains and lively ambiance, Piazza Navona is a vibrant square filled with street artists, cafes, and baroque architecture. It’s the perfect place to soak in local culture while enjoying a gelato.

Best time to go to Vatican

The best time to visit Vatican can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Vatican falls in August, when vis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. The coolest average temperature around Vatican fal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January46.9°F (8.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
February48.0°F (8.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
March51.8°F (11.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April57.4°F (14.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May64.4°F (18.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
June73.6°F (23.1°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
July79.3°F (26.3°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ighAverage
August79.7°F (26.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
September72.3°F (22.4°C)Light R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
October64.4°F (18.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
November56.5°F (13.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
December49.3°F (9.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age

How can I get around Vatican and the greater Rome area?
If you want to see more of the city, Ottaviano - San Pietro - Musei Vaticani Station is the closest metro stop. Others nearby include Risorgimento/S. Pietro Tram Stop and Milizie-Angelico Tram Stop. If you want to venture out of town, Rome Valle Aurelia Station is the closest train station. You can also catch a ride at Rome San Pietro Station.
